The Catch – And There Is One
Let’s not pretend this is all upside. A £1 minimum deposit casino narrows your options. Not every brand accepts that kind of money, so you lose access to some big names. Payment methods also get squeezed – e-wallets often require a higher minimum, and bank transfers can be sluggish for tiny amounts. The real kicker: most welcome bonuses demand a £10 deposit minimum. That £1 sign-up won’t trigger a free spins offer.
There’s also a psychological trap. Dropping a quid feels like nothing. Drop a quid ten times in a session, and suddenly you’ve spent a tenner without noticing. Accumulative losses are real, and they’re easier to ignore when each hit is small.
